good story to share

After spending a weekend away with my adult son,I was so impressed by his generous heart,I sent him this email.
"Dear son,i want to thank you for teaching me a very valuable lesson in life by the great example you set.When we were eating at that cafe in Bondi and a person who'd ordered his burger didn't have enough money to pay for it,without a moment's hesitation,you leant over an put the extra $2 on the counter.
"When we were leaving,you also threw a silver five-cent coin onto the pavement and said something like,'Some kid will get a kick out of finding this.'
"Last week,a young man ahead of me in the line at a petrol station didn't have enough money to pay for his petrol.I asked the cashier.'How much short is he?' She told me he had meant to put $15 of petrol in his car but had been looking at the wrong gauge and had put in 15 litres,which came to just over $20.40 - an easy mistake as both gauges run fast.
"Something made me think of you and what you did that night in the cafe at Bondi.I handed the man $6.
He was so surprise and said,"But why would you do this for me?'I just smiled as i thought of you.
"Thank you son,for teaching me that it's better to give than receive'.Now when i see a five-cent coin on the ground and am tempted to pick it up,i think of you and leave it there,just in case 'some kid will get a kick out of finding it'.
